Ingredients Overview for Easy Gluten Free Spinach Pie Parcels
Here’s what you will need to get started on this delightful recipe:
- Gluten-Free Pastry: Pre-made gluten-free pastry sheets work great! You can also make your own if you’re up for it.
- Fresh Spinach: Spinach gives a fresh, bright flavor. You could swap it for kale if you’re feeling adventurous!
- Feta Cheese: This adds a creamy, salty twist, but you could substitute with goat cheese if that’s your jam.
- Ricotta Cheese: Creamy and rich, this balances the salty feta beautifully. Cottage cheese is a nice alternative.
- Egg: Helps bind everything together. A flax egg works perfectly for a vegan swap.
- Oregano: Dried or fresh, this herb gives a lovely aromatic touch.
- Salt and Pepper: Essential for bringing all those flavors to life.
Step-by-Step Instructions for Easy Gluten Free Spinach Pie Parcels
Making these parcels is a breeze! Here’s how to do it:
- Preheat the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 375°F (190°C).
- Prepare Spinach Mixture: In a pan over medium heat, sauté the fresh spinach until wilted. Let it cool a bit before squeezing out any excess moisture.
- Mix Filling: In a large bowl, combine the sautéed spinach, feta, ricotta, egg, oregano, salt, and pepper. Stir until well mixed.
- Roll Out Pastry: On a lightly floured surface (using gluten-free flour), roll out your pastry sheets. Cut into squares or circles, about 4-6 inches wide.
- Fill Pastry: Place a generous spoonful of the filling in the center of each pastry piece.
- Seal: Fold the pastry over to enclose the filling and press the edges together with your fingers or a fork to seal.
- Bake: Place the parcels on a parchment-lined baking sheet and brush with a bit of melted butter or an egg wash for a golden finish. Bake for about 20-25 minutes, or until golden and crispy.
- Cool and Serve: Let them cool for a few minutes, then enjoy warm or at room temperature!

Tips for the Perfect Easy Gluten Free Spinach Pie Parcels
- Use Fresh Spinach: It has a better texture and flavor than frozen.
- Don’t Overfill: A little filling goes a long way! Overfilling can lead to messy parcels.
- Seal Tightly: Make sure edges are well sealed to prevent them from opening while baking.
- Experiment with Flavors: Feel free to add in some sun-dried tomatoes or olives for a fun twist.
Q&A Section
Q1: Can I freeze these parcels?
Absolutely! They freeze very well. Just make sure to let them cool completely before freezing.
Q2: How long do they take to bake?
Baking usually takes around 20-25 minutes at 375°F (190°C) until they turn golden brown.
Q3: What can I substitute for the cheese?
You can swap the cheeses for vegan options, or even leave them out altogether and add more vegetables.
Q4: Can I make them 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are the filling and assemble the parcels ahead of time. Just bake when you are ready to serve!

Easy Gluten Free Spinach Pie Parcels
Ingredients
For the pastry and filling
- 1 package Gluten-Free Pastry Pre-made gluten-free pastry sheets work great.
- 4 cups Fresh Spinach You could swap it for kale if desired.
- 1 cup Feta Cheese Can substitute with goat cheese.
- 1 cup Ricotta Cheese Cottage cheese is a good alternative.
- 1 large Egg For a vegan option, use a flax egg.
- 1 tablespoon Oregano Dried or fresh.
- to taste Salt Essential for flavor.
- to taste Pepper Essential for flavor.
Instructions
Preparation
-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
- In a pan over medium heat, sauté the fresh spinach until wilted. Let it cool before squeezing out excess moisture.
- In a large bowl, combine the sautéed spinach, feta, ricotta, egg, oregano, salt, and pepper. Stir until well mixed.
- On a lightly floured surface (using gluten-free flour), roll out your pastry sheets and cut into squares or circles, about 4-6 inches wide.
- Place a generous spoonful of the filling in the center of each pastry piece.
- Fold the pastry over to enclose the filling and press the edges together with fingers or a fork to seal.
- Place the parcels on a parchment-lined baking sheet and brush with melted butter or an egg wash for a golden finish.
- Bake for about 20-25 minutes, or until golden and crispy.
- Let them cool for a few minutes, then enjoy warm or at room temperature.
